Energy-efficient

Double glazing can lower your energy costs by helping to keep heat in and cold out. They can also create an ambiance that is quieter and increase the value of your property. If you'd like your home to be as green friendly as possible, consider switching to double-glazed windows that feature Low-E glass. This kind of glass is coated with a special coating to reflect sunlight. It reduces the transfer of heat into your home and increases comfort.

Stronger glass

Modern double-glazed windows are more robust than single-pane windows from the past and have an insulating space between them. This helps to reduce the loss of heat and boost energy efficiency. It also serves as a shield against noise pollution. Depending on the kind of window, it may have low-emissivity, or argon gas to increase insulation, and also a toughened glass for increased safety. Low-maintenance

Double glazing is a window consisting of two glass panes and a space between them. The space is filled with gas, typically argon or krypton, which helps to keep heat from leaving your home. This will reduce your energy bills and make your home quieter. The windows are designed to last a lifetime and are available in a variety of styles and finishes. Reduces UV Rays

Double glazing is a window type that has two panes set in a frame, creating an insulation pocket. These windows are designed to block heat from escaping the home and also provide an insulating barrier against colder temperatures and noise. They can be used to replace single-paned windows in new homes or for existing windows. Also referred to as Insulated units (IGUs) They are typically used in new construction homes.

The space between the two panes in double-glazed windows is typically filled with a gas that is inert, such as Krypton or argon. This gas provides an additional layer of insulation and increases the window's R-value. The gap between panes can be tinted or annealed for better thermal performance.

Another benefit of double-glazed windows is that they cut down on the amount of UV rays that enter your house. This is crucial since exposure to UV rays can cause damage to furniture and textiles. replacement double glazed units near me glazing can prevent condensation that can make your home smell musty odor and promote the growth mildew spores which can erode woodwork or upholstery.

Reduces noise

Double glazing reduces the noise pollution by separating the air inside your home from outside. Its insulating properties block noise from escaping through the window, but it also dampens sound waves, making it easier to enjoy a an unwinding night's sleep. Its thermal efficiency also helps keep your home warm throughout the year, reducing heating costs.

The gap between the two glass panes blocks out condensation, preventing it from spreading throughout your home. Condensation can cause mildew spores to grow and can cause damage to soft furniture woodwork, paintings, and other furniture. Double glazing decreases the amount of moisture in your house, thereby preserving your furniture and preventing mold and mildew.
